Abstract
PURPOSE: To make it possible to make an automatic zero adjustment druing power measurement by making the zero adjustment and power adjustment in time-division mode.
CONSTITUTION: When the output voltage value of low-frequency rectanglular wave oscillator 24 is "1", switch circuit 21 in ON and switch circuit 23 OFF. Then, the output voltage of high-frequency power supply 1 to be measured is converted by converter 22 of power measuring circuit 9 into a voltage signal in proportion to the output power value of power supply 1, and it is added 3 to the memory voltage of memory circuit 8, amplified 4 and then supplied to indicator 51. Next, when the output voltage value of oscillator 24 is "0", circuit 21 if OFF, and circuit 23 ON. As a result, the output voltage of converter 22 generates an error voltage by leaking power of circuit 21 or a leaking current of circuit 3 and it is added 3 to the output voltage of circuit 8 and amplified 4 before being negatively fed back to the other input terminal of circuit 3 by way of negative feedback circuit 6 and circuits 23 and 8 so that the output voltage of circuit 4 will be zero. Therefore, the power measurement and zero adjustment can alternatively be performed according to the output of oscillator 24.
